为什么有人学编程语言很难

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    学习编程语言对于许多人来说确实是一项具有挑战性的任务。这是因为编程语言不同于我们通常使用的自然语言,需要具备一定的逻辑思维和抽象能力。以下是一些可能导致学习编程语言困难的原因:

    1.抽象概念:编程语言是用来描述计算机如何执行任务的工具。它们包括许多抽象概念,如变量、函数、条件语句、循环等。对于初学者来说,理解这些概念并将它们转化为实际的代码可能会带来困难。

    2.语法规则:每种编程语言都有其特定的语法规则,这些规则规定了如何正确地书写代码。对于初学者来说,正确使用语法可能需要花费一定时间和精力。

    3.逻辑思维:编程语言涉及到逻辑思维的应用,需要学习如何将问题分解为小的逻辑单元,并使用正确的语法和语义来解决问题。这对于一些人来说是一项具有挑战性的任务。

    4.实践经验:学习编程语言需要不断的实践和练习。编写代码并调试错误是提高编程技能的有效途径。然而,缺乏实践经验可能会导致学习进度缓慢。

    尽管学习编程语言可能具有一定的困难,但通过选择适合自己的学习资源、进行充分的实践和培养正确的学习态度,这些困难是可以克服的。毅力、耐心和持续的学习是成功学习编程语言的关键。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    学习编程语言对许多人来说确实是一项挑战。以下是一些可能解释为什么有些人觉得学习编程语言很难的原因:

    1. 抽象思维:编程语言的逻辑和概念通常与日常生活的思维方式有一定的差异。编程语言的思维模式通常更加抽象,需要学习者具备一定程度的逻辑思维和抽象能力。对于不习惯或不擅长抽象思维的人来说,学习编程语言可能会比较困难。

    2. 语法复杂:不同的编程语言具有不同的语法规则和语法要求。有些编程语言的语法相对简单,而其他语言的语法则比较复杂。学习者需要理解并熟悉编程语言的语法规则,如变量声明、循环、条件语句等,这可能需要花费一定的时间和精力。

    3. 技术概念:学习编程语言还需要掌握一系列的技术概念,如数据类型、函数、类、对象等。对于初学者来说,这些概念可能会相对陌生,需要耐心学习和理解。学习者需要建立起对这些概念的理解和应用能力,才能在编程实践中灵活运用。

    4. 缺乏实践机会:学习编程语言不仅需要理论知识,更需要实践经验。通过实践编写代码,学习者才能真正理解和掌握编程语言的应用。然而,对于一些学习者来说,缺乏实践机会是一个挑战。没有足够的练习项目或实践环境可能会使学习编程语言的过程变得困难。

    5. 缺乏耐心和毅力:学习编程语言需要一定的耐心和毅力。编程并不是一项一蹴而就的技能,而是需要不断地实践和思考。对于一些学习者来说,缺乏耐心和毅力可能会使他们在学习编程语言的过程中感到困惑和灰心。

    尽管学习编程语言可能会有一些困难,但随着时间的推移和不断的实践,大多数人仍然可以克服这些困难并掌握编程语言。重要的是保持积极的态度、勤奋学习并寻找合适的学习资源和实践机会。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    学习编程语言对于一些人来说确实是一项具有挑战性的任务。以下是一些可能导致学习编程语言困难的原因:

    1. 缺乏编程经验:对于没有编程经验的人来说,学习编程语言可能是一个全新的领域。编程概念和思维方式可能与他们之前接触过的其他学科不同,需要适应和学习。

    2. 复杂的语法和符号:每种编程语言都有其独特的语法和符号,初学者需要记住大量的关键词、运算符和语法规则。这对于一些人来说可能是困难的,特别是对于那些没有接触过类似的符号体系的人来说。

    3. 抽象概念:编程涉及到一些抽象的概念,如变量、函数、条件语句和循环等。初学者可能需要花费一些时间理解这些概念以及它们之间的关系。

    4. 缺乏实践经验:学习编程语言需要实践和练习。对于一些人来说,没有足够的时间或机会进行实际的编程练习,这会导致学习进程缓慢。

    5. 缺乏适合的学习资源和指导:优质的学习资源和指导对于学习编程语言非常重要。如果初学者没有找到适合自己的教材或学习平台,他们可能会感到困惑和挫败。

    那么,如何克服这些困难并有效地学习编程语言呢?以下是一些建议:

    1. 确定学习目标:设定明确的学习目标,并制定一个合理的学习计划。这将帮助您有条不紊地学习,并跟踪自己的进展。

    2. 寻找优质的学习资源:选择一本权威的编程教材、参加在线课程或加入编程学习社区。确保您选择的资源适合您的学习水平和学习风格。

    3. 练习实践:学习编程语言最重要的部分是实践。尝试解决编程问题和练习编写代码。可以通过编写小程序、参加编程挑战或参与实际项目来提高实践能力。

    4. 寻找同伴和导师:寻找其他学习编程的人进行交流和合作。他们可以提供帮助和支持,并与您一起解决问题。此外,寻求专业导师的指导也是一个不错的选择。

    5. 坚持和耐心:学习编程需要时间和耐心。不要灰心丧气,相信自己的能力,并坚持学习。每天保持一定的学习时间,并逐渐提高学习的难度。

    总之,学习编程语言可能是一项具有挑战性的任务,但通过坚持学习、练习和适当的指导,任何人都可以克服困难并成为一名优秀的程序员。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部